Top Three Values for The Players Championship

Andrew Putnam ($20)

Quietly one of the hottest players on the PGA Tour, Putnam has put together six pretty impressive starts. It all began at the Desert Classic, where he came in 21st. Since then, he has three top-10s and two other made cuts. Putnam is also the minimum salary this week and will provide plenty of chances to get in your favorite star players.

Emiliano Grillo ($20)

It has been a bit of a topsy-turvy year for Grillo, but the last two weeks have looked much better, as he finished in the top 25 in each event. He doesn’t have a long ball off the tee, relying a bit more on his ability to find the fairway at a higher rate than normal, which helps his stronger-than-average approach game. Another top-25 here at almost the minimum salary presents some great value.

Jordan Spieth ($31)

Putnam may be one of the hottest golfers on tour, but Spieth is the absolute hottest golfer on the planet right now. He has four straight finishes inside the top 15, including three top-fives, all at different types of courses. From Pebble to Riviera and Bay Hill, Spieth has performed admirably on all of them. His salary is also below many golfers that he’s playing way better than right now, so utilizing him as the best $30-plus value should help you create some great balanced lineups.

PGA DFS Yahoo Cup Lineup Builds

Aggressive Build

If you want to trust that you’ll be able to get three golfers at the minimum salary through the cut, then this strategy could really pan out if you can pair them up with the three studs that performed the best this week. Given that the average player budget remaining is $46 per player, you can get virtually any three studs in one lineup except for Justin Thomas, Jon Rahm and Dustin Johnson.

Conservative Build

Taking only one of the min-salary golfers and pairing them up with Spieth and Bezuidenhout still provides plenty of budget to add in some big names. In fact, in my lineup, I still have two guys with salaries over $40. Use this strategy if you think the top-end golfers will underperform this week.
